Spending Thanksgiving on the Outer Banks with family is a great way to kick off the holiday season. November weather is generally mild, with highs in the mid-60s, with lows dipping to the 50s at night. It’s possible to have a sunny Thanksgiving Day that is warm enough to spend a good portion of the day relaxing on the beach. In that case, we recommend planning ahead for your Thanksgiving meal. Thanksgiving on the Outer Banks, Complete with Oysters

Oysters are a great way to add a little bit of the Outer Banks to a traditional Thanksgiving meal, and November is prime oyster season. See our comprehensive OBX oyster guide for a list of where to buy oysters on the Outer Banks, as well as some of our favorite ways to prepare and eat them.
